Collective nouns are nouns that refer to a collection or group of multiple people, animals, or things. However, even though collective nouns refer to multiple individuals, they still usually function as singular nouns in a sentence. Many terms for groups of animals were first recorded in The Book of St. Albans , published in 1486, and their use flourished among hunters.
